To help you find the best solution and the most suitable programme for your son or daughter Redcliff provides this complementary assessment service.

This instrument measures a wide range of troublesome behaviours, situations and moods which commonly apply to troublesome young people, including intrapersonal distress, physcosomatic, interpersonal relations, critical items, social problems and behaviour dysfunction.

The results of the assessment normally takes 1 to 2 days to process and one of our advisors will call you back to review the outcome.
